Two CEE at Illinois graduate students walked away with poster session prizes at the 2022 Geo-Resolution Conference hosted by National Geospatial-Intelligence Agency and Saint Louis University (SLU) on September 28, 2022.

Laura Gray received first place for her poster, Impacts of global climate change on total runoff. Gray is co-advised by CEE at Illinois associate professor Ashlynn S. Stillwell and assistant professor Lei Zhao. Jenni Nugent, who is advised by Stillwell, received third place for her poster, Monthly Virtual Blue and Grey Water Transfers on the U.S. Electric Grid.

Poster topics covered a wide range of research topics connected to geospatial sciences or using geospatial tools. Winners were determined by a panel of geospatial experts led by SLU faculty member Ness Sandoval.
